0 reports about 3876629600The number was first reported 3rd Aug, 2025
Received a phone call from 3876629600? Report here
File a report about 3876629600 |
Phone Number Variations: 3876629600, 03876-629600, 913876629600, 003876629600, 1913876629600, +1913876629600